Sensory Neurons
Nerve cells responsible for converting external stimuli from the environment into internal electrical impulses for the brain to interpret.
Central Nervous System
The complex network of the brain and spinal cord that is responsible for processing and sending out all the signals that control the body.
Peripheral Nervous System
The part of the nervous system that consists of the nerves and ganglia outside of the brain and spinal cord, connecting the central nervous system to limbs and organs.
Spinal Cord
A long, thin, tubular structure made up of nervous tissue, which extends from the medulla oblongata in the brainstem to the lumbar region of the vertebral column; it transmits neural signals between the brain and the rest of the body.
